Ferrari have confirmed their four drivers that will take part in the tests following the
Spanish Grand Prix, at the Barcelona-Catalunya circuit.
On Tuesday the two regular
Ferrari drivers,
Sebastian Vettel and
Charles Leclerc will test on track but for two different reasons. Leclerc will be driving for the Scuderia whilst
Sebastian Vettel will still be behind the wheel of the SF90 but will be testing for tyre supplier, Pirelli.
On Wednesday
Charles Leclerc will once again be on track but for Pirelli whilst Antonio Fuoco makes his third test appearance for the team as he will be driving for Ferrari. The current simulator driver drove at the Spielberg test in 2015 as well as in Barcelona during the 2016 season.
Callum Ilott will be apart of the
Alfa Romeo test team during the Tuesday session. The Brit is currently competing in Formula 2 for the ART Grand Prix team but has never driven an F1 car.
The test sessions will take place on Tuesday 14 and Wednesday 15 May.
